Born and raised in Newfoundland, Jillian decided she wanted to become a physiotherapist after injuring her hand while playing sports.
She obtained a Bachelor of Science (Honours) with a major in Behavioural Neuroscience and a minor in Chemistry from Memorial University of Newfoundland, followed by a Master of Science in Physiotherapy from Robert Gordon University in Scotland.
After completing her master's degree in 2013, Jillian moved to Ottawa, Ontario, where she practised for eight years. During that time, she was nominated for Physiotherapist of the Year in the Faces Magazine Ottawa Awards. Jillian returned to Newfoundland in 2021.
Jillian is always looking for the latest research-supported methods and techniques to offer the best possible care to her clients. She is passionate about Mechanical Diagnosis and Therapy (MDT), also known as the McKenzie Method. She is the Project Manager for the MICANADA Development Committee for MDT Awareness and is a certified MDT clinician, one of only two in Newfoundland.
She has additional training in acupuncture, dry needling, temporomandibular joint (TMJ) dysfunction, concussion management, and vestibular rehabilitation, including the assessment and treatment of vertigo. She has an active treatment style focused on empowering clients to take control of their pain through education and individualised exercise programs, supplemented with manual therapy.
When Jillian isn't seeing patients, she keeps active by walking her dog, Cashew, and exercising. Her favourite forms of exercise are strength training, yoga, and kickboxing.
She believes that exercise and education are the foundations of recovery and are essential to helping people achieve a healthier, more active life.
